Anchor System. The anchor system is a set of pulleys and cam cleats that are attached to the frame and stern mount. This system allows you to lift up and lower down your anchor from the front of your raft. You run your rope through this system and attach your anchor weight to the stern end, which is detailed above.

Mushroom anchors. The most common choice for boaters when mooring, these mooring anchors are available in weights from 25 pounds up to 1000 pounds or more.
